Framed Print of Ships figureheads over the gate at Castles Shipbreaking Yard, Westminster, London, 1909

Ships figureheads over the gate at Castles Shipbreaking Yard, Baltic Wharf, Millbank, Westminster, London, March 1909. Entrance to the yard, with wooden figures salvaged from ships decorating the sign. Heritage Images features heritage image collections. © The London Archives (City of London)/Heritage Images
